It looks like the 62 Strato Flite tank is the same as the Fleetline tank except the red/chrome color scheme is reversed.
Physically, they should be the same tank and should fit on the frame just fine.

1707841974775.png




1707842015168.png
 
Just make sure that the tank is for a men's bike and not a ladies.
